Have each {quote: BtShared} structure hang on to a buffer of just under page-size bytes for temporary use. This reduces the number of calls to malloc(). (CVS 4914)

/*
** Make sure pBt->pTmpSpace points to an allocation of
** MX_CELL_SIZE(pBt) bytes.
*/
static void allocateTempSpace(BtShared *pBt){
if( !pBt->pTmpSpace ){
pBt->pTmpSpace = sqlite3_malloc(MX_CELL_SIZE(pBt));
}
}
